KAMAREDDY: Karnataka Chief Minister Siddaramaiah said that people of Telangana are waiting for November 30, 2023 to vote out Chief Minister K Chandrashekar Rao (KCR) and his Government.

Campaigning for Telangana Pradesh Congress Committee (TPCC) president Revanth Reddy in Kamareddy on Friday, Siddaramaiah said, "People of Telangana have decided to defeat KCR. Revanth Reddy is contesting in two seats will win both and defeat KCR with a huge majority.

"All of you know that KCR is trying to win elections by bribing voters but they have decided to defeat him," he said.

Targetting the BJP, Siddaramiah said, "According to my information, BJP can win upto a maximum of four to five. I am confident that even if Narendra Modi campaigns here for 100 times, BJP candidates are sure to lose their deposits. In fact, wherever Modi did road shows in Karnataka, Congress candidates won with a huge majority."

Sharing that he has never seen a Prime Minister lie so much, the Karnataka Chief Minister said, "The country's economy has taken a back seat after Modi became the Prime Minister. There is a loss of Rs 1,25,000 crore. People of Telangana will teach a fitting lesson to the BJP.

"He came to Telangana and organised a BC Mahasabha where he projected himself as a saviour of backward classes. But he hasn't carried out any programmes for them. Ironically it is because of Modi that they are still backward," he said.

Defending the guarantee schemes declared by the Congress, Siddaramiah said, "The Congress declared five guarantees for Karnataka. Modi and KCR said it was impossible to impelement it. But once the Government was formed in Karnataka, we implemented it in a week. Today, Karnataka has become strong financially after implementing the schemes. Modi is shaking with fear because of this.

"If KCR is saying that it is difficult to implement the guarantees, I will ask him to come and tour Karnataka and we will show him how we are implementing the schemes. Just like Karnataka, we will implement the schemes in Telangana. The Congress is the only party in the country which will provide justice to BCs, SCs an other marginalised communities," he said.

Summary of Kamareddy BC declaration

- Congress has promised to increase BC reservation based on caste census and BC Commission report within six months of assuming power.

- Promise to increase BC reservations from the existing 23 per cent to 42 per cent in local bodies.

- Promises to provide Rs 20,000 crore per year for BC welfare.

- Telangana Congress has also pledged community specific promises for the dominant BC communities such as Mudiraj, Yadava/Kuruma, Goud, Munnur Kapu, Padmashali, Vishwakarma and Rajaka.
